Transaction 8e810fc89fdadd730b110b801d9730fd1aa6fdde73915e764acf76185a0451ea

2 Input
2 Outputs
  • 8e810fc89fdadd730b110b801d9730fd1aa6fdde73915e764acf76185a0451ea:0
  • value  100520
    address  12HarwPfx39Q9LhA7xvQTe2dTQJrPPo1ax
  • 8e810fc89fdadd730b110b801d9730fd1aa6fdde73915e764acf76185a0451ea:1
  • value  1034140
    address  18MMTXF7FxN7BKYsNygDk9f1SGBrhtZyDQ